چکیده انگلیسی
The results of the influence of rheological properties and universal components of a fresh High Performance Self-compacting Concrete (HPSCC) on the content of entrapped air in the concrete mix are presented in the paper. The nature of changes the air content in fresh HPSCC depends on rheological parameters. When yield value g and plastic viscosity h decrease thereby diameter of slump flow increase and time of slump flow decrease then air content in mixture also decrease. The results of tests show that we can predict the influence of rheological properties (yield stress, plastic viscosity or diameter and propagation time) on air content in fresh HPSCC by statistical model presented in the text of the paper. Obtaining the air content of less than 2% of the fresh concrete is possible if the diameter of slump flow is greater than 65 cm - according to the slump-flow test (yield stress limit is less than 250 N mm - according to tests performed rheometer BT) and the time of slump flow is less than 16 s (plastic viscosity h less than 14,000 N mm s - measured by rheometer BT2).
